According to the FDA Adverse Event Reporting System (FAERS), 7 reports of On and off phenomenon have been filed in association with FUROSEMIDE (Furosemide). This represents 0.0% of all adverse event reports for FUROSEMIDE.

Is On and off phenomenon Listed in the Official Label?
This adverse event is not currently listed in the official FDA drug label for FUROSEMIDE. However, 7 reports have been filed with the FAERS database.
